NEW YORK (CBSNewYork) – It was a harrowing scene at a McDonald’s in Queens after a man walked into the restaurant with a knife sticking out of his back.

The incident occurred around 10 a.m. Tuesday at the McDonald’s on Sutphin Boulevard and 91st Street in Jamaica.

Witnesses said minutes earlier, they saw two men fighting on the street corner.

The victim was stabbed in the back, but managed to walk down the block and into the restaurant, witnesses said.

“Everybody was standing there to make sure he didn’t fall backwards on the knife,” witness Tromaine Yancey told CBS 2. “He was on the phone, I’m pretty sure he was on the phone talking to somebody in his family or a loved one, he was talking to them and telling them it might be the last time he’s speaking to them, he just wanted them to hear his voice.”

The victim was taken to Jamaica Hospital in serious condition.

No arrests have been made.
